🚀 Feature
💅 Enhancement
- [cli] CLI: Improve command descriptions (#12359) @gu-stav
- [core:admin] Product copy API Tokens (#12424) @ronronscelestes
- [core:admin] Link to web marketplace from admin (#12491) @remidej
- [core:admin] Put CM links injection zone on top of the other links (#12519) @soupette
- [core:database] Add ability to use $null: false and $notNull: false (#11823) @petersg83
- [core:strapi] optimization and refactoring the verify function (#12037) @tuxuuman
- [dependencies] Update sharp in upload plugin (#12532) @konstantinmuenster
- [plugin:graphql] Allow SDL type definitions to beneficiate from Nexus types context & processing (#12404) @Convly
- [plugin:graphql] Add configuration options to generate graphql schema + types (#12467) @Convly
- [plugin:sentry] Update Sentry plugin docs for v4 (#12396) @remidej
- [tooling] Change dependanbot config to only upgrade non major versions (#12437) @alexandrebodin
- [upload] Allow removing assets before uploading (#12428) @gu-stav
🚨 Security
🐛 Bug fix
- [core:admin] Enable to drop image to upload dialog in edit view (#12266) @iicdii
- [core:admin] Fixed hot reload in admin (#12413) @yasudacloud
- [core:admin] Clear datetime or date should set value to null (#12445) @smoothdvd
- [core:content-manager] Handle direct quotes in JSON field (#12474) @petersg83
- [core:content-manager] Fixing Drag ordering bug with Nested Component. (#12504) @godzzo
- [core:database] Deprecate for Date format different from yyyy-MM-dd + don't cast DATE from DB to Date() (#12234) @petersg83
- [plugin:documentation] Fix custom settings override (#12465) @markkaylor
- [plugin:i18n] Add all non-localized fields (media, compo, dz) in /get-non-localized-fields response (#12183) @petersg83
- [plugin:sentry] Fix sentry plugin calling sendError on wrong object (#12067) @derweili
- [plugin:users-permissions] remove extra '/' in baseURL (#12410) @smoothdvd